1. Determine the Type of Event
Before you start your search for the perfect Easter Bunny, it's important to determine what kind of event you’re hosting. The type of event will help you decide on the Bunny rental package that best suits your needs.
- Easter Party: If you're hosting a family or community party, you may want to consider a Bunny that can interact with guests, take photos, and participate in activities like egg hunts or games.
- Easter Photoshoot: For a more focused experience, like a family photoshoot, you might only need the Bunny for a brief period to pose for pictures with your guests.
- Corporate Event or Community Gathering: For larger gatherings, the Easter Bunny can help create a lively atmosphere, and you might want additional services like Easter-themed games or entertainment.
Understanding your event type will help you choose the right Bunny rental service and plan your event accordingly.
2. Find a Reputable Easter Bunny Rental Service
Once you’ve determined the needs of your event, it's time to find a reputable Bunny rental service. There are several ways to find a trustworthy provider:
- Local Event Services: Check with local event planners, party rental companies, or entertainment agencies that may offer Easter Bunny rentals.
- Online Directories: Websites like Yelp, Thumbtack, or Google Search can help you find Easter Bunny rental services in your area. Look for services with good reviews, photos, and a strong track record of providing fun experiences.
- Social Media: Local Facebook groups, Instagram, and community boards can also be a great way to find recommendations from others who have rented Easter Bunnies in the past.
Be sure to read reviews, ask for photos from previous events, and check the service’s policies regarding costumes, pricing, and availability.
3. Consider Your Budget and Package Options
The cost of renting an Easter Bunny will vary depending on several factors, such as the duration of the rental, the type of event, and any additional services included in the package.
Rental packages may include:
- Basic Package: Includes the Easter Bunny’s appearance for photos and brief interactions with guests.
- Extended Package: Includes longer time with the Bunny, such as participating in games or hosting an Easter egg hunt.
- Premium Package: May offer extras like professional photoshoots, themed decorations, Easter egg hunt coordination, or additional performers.
Ask the rental service about available packages and what’s included. Don’t hesitate to inquire about any discounts or special deals for booking early or for multiple hours of service.
4. Check for Customization Options
To make your event truly unique, inquire if the Bunny rental service offers customization options. This could include:
- Themed Costumes: Some Bunny services provide different costume options (classic, pastel-themed, or even a trendy, modern look). You can choose one that matches the style of your event.
- Activity Involvement: If you’re hosting an egg hunt or organizing games, ask if the Bunny can lead or participate in these activities.
- Photo Opportunities: Some providers offer photo packages, where they take professional-quality pictures of the Bunny with your guests or during your egg hunt.
Customizing the Bunny’s appearance or activities ensures that the character aligns with your event’s theme and goals.
5. Confirm Availability
As Easter approaches, Bunny rental services often become busy. To ensure you get the Easter Bunny you want, it’s important to book early.
- Reserve Early: Popular dates around Easter weekend fill up quickly, so reach out and confirm your booking as soon as possible.
- Date Flexibility: If your event falls close to Easter but isn’t on the holiday itself, some services may offer more availability, so check for alternatives if your preferred date is already booked.
Booking well in advance gives you the best chance to secure the perfect Bunny for your spring celebration.
6. Ask About Insurance and Safety Protocols
When renting an Easter Bunny, make sure the service follows proper safety protocols, especially if you're hosting a large crowd. Ask about the performer’s training and how they handle interactions with children, as well as any insurance policies the company has in place in case of any incidents.
Additionally, inquire about hygiene practices for costumes, ensuring that the Easter Bunny arrives in clean and well-maintained attire.
7. Coordinate the Bunny's Role at Your Event
To ensure everything goes smoothly on the day of your event, have a clear plan for how you want the Easter Bunny to participate. Here are some key details to communicate with the rental service:
- Arrival Time: Make sure to coordinate the Bunny's arrival time, allowing for setup before guests arrive. If you're planning a photoshoot, factor in enough time to get the Bunny ready.
- Activities: If you’re planning games, an Easter egg hunt, or special activities, inform the Bunny rental service beforehand. Provide a timeline or outline of the event so they know how to interact with guests and lead activities.
- Breaks: The Easter Bunny performer will likely need breaks throughout the event. Discuss the timing of these breaks so there’s no disruption to your celebration.
Being prepared and organized will ensure a seamless experience for both your guests and the Bunny!
8. Communicate with the Easter Bunny Performer
If possible, establish a line of communication with the person who will be dressed as the Bunny. This allows you to share any special instructions, preferences, or event details. The performer will appreciate knowing how they can best engage with your guests and ensure everyone has a great time.
